List vars in Data warehouse reports

Hi- this might be a fairly basic question for someone familiar with Data warehouse reports, but I'm new to it, any help would be appreciated!

 

I was trying to fetch data as follows-

The first dimension (say d1) was broken down by another dimension (say d2), further broken down by dimension d3 which is a list var.

 

I expected the report to look something like this-

d1           d2                 d3

A             X                  a,b

 

However, the report looked something like this-

d1           d2                d3

A             X                  a

A             X                  b

 

Is this an expected behaviour or am I missing something?

Hi @prerna ,

This is an expected behavior. Each unique de-limited listvar value show up in a different row.
For example:

s.list1 = “value1|value2|value3”;
When we will look at the report in UI for listVar1 (de-limited by ‘|’) we will see different rows as “value1”, “value2” and "value3".
Furthermore, we also have the DW report preview section to know how the report format will look like-
